I just bought a 705 Gold Pack so his makes me a noob with noob questions!

I have a CTX and decided on this machine primarliy because it is much lighter, has a back light for night hunting, runs at 18.5Khz which should help in the local tot lots where there is a lot of EMI and comes with a DD coil for my Seattle mineralized soil. I've been doing some air tests on a small 18k chain and found that the machine seems to pick the chain up best in all metal mode. It appears that the factory discrimination patterns don't see the gold chain (at least very). My question is what are you guys doing to make sure you don't miss gold chains? Are you modifying pattern 1 by accepting more TID's? Running in All Metal? Running in Iron Mask? I'm hoping this machine will compliment my CTX by picking up the small stuff.
 
Good chains can be tough. Take one out and put it on the ground and swipe over it. Depending on the orientation it can give you way different numbers.

It's best to run as little discrimination as you can stand to listen to. I typically run with the two bottom numbers notched out and also 48.

Small gold chains are iffy targets.........I have never dug one up,the ones i have detected were down in the grass or just under the sand... the 10kt 12g bracelet, i found last weekend,laid out unclasped was just covered in the sand and a iffy 2/4 TID......I hunt in AM....4 tone,99% of the time.........

This 10k CZ bracelet was ground into the soccer field it was a solid 8TID....It will find them!
